From mimicking commercial restaurants to adding convenience, retail operations are getting creative and bringing in new sources of revenue. Take a look at these four revenue-boosting operations:

Central Table: The future of healthcare dining? >>

Located inside a St. Louis hospital, Central Table has evolved from a food hall to a full-service restaurant and bar with aspirations to change the healthcare foodservice industry.

Upscale eatery serves growing corporate complex >>

Arcade Café emphasizes scratch-cooked choices and local ingredients as much as possible.

Thinking commercial boosts Texas district’s meal program >>

Concepts that mimic popular restaurant brands—including an actual Red Mango station—create buzz in Northwest ISD high schools.

BYU Turns Bank into Retail Outlet >>

BYU Food To Go offers catering items and a small retail store to customers off campus.
